Causes React PropType errors to fail the test
Conditionally require a React proptype based on other props and/or other conditions.
validates style objects by ensuring they only have valid keys
Babel plugin to add react-docgen info into your code
This package contains common prop types used across dhis2 apps and libraries.
async error handler
Call a function and catch any errors it throws
PropType validators that work with Immutable.js.
React proptype for moment module
Catcher shared type definitions — zero runtime dependencies
JavaScript errors tracking for Hawk.so
UI snapshot testing for React Native
Shared utilities for Element React
Custom classes for Type-safe handling of exceptions in your application.
Catcher HTTP client for browsers — fetch-based with retry, circuit breaker & priority queue
catcher HTTP native addon for Node.js via napi-rs
catcher WebSocket native addon for Node.js via napi-rs
React PropType to conditionally add `.isRequired` based on other props
Catcher WebSocket client — resilient reconnect, multi-endpoint racing, msgpack codec
Create typescript definitions files (d.ts) from react components
Catcher HTTP client — resilient transport with retry, circuit breaker, priority scheduling
Simple reusable React error boundary component
Web Interface for reading and testing notifications during development
Vite plugin for sending source-maps to the Hawk